Mobile App Product Manager
About the role
The Mobile App Product Manager will be responsible for developing KnitWell Group’s iOS and Android apps, delivering an exceptional omnichannel experience for millions of customers across our family of brands. The candidate will possess both excellent communication and analytical skills and bring a highly collaborative approach to developing, prioritizing, executing and measuring the new KnitWell mobile app. You can equally converse with a marketer and developer, with laser-sharp capability in translating needs to requirements, priorities to development to releases with measurable outcomes. As a founding member of the customer app team, you will bring a passion for fashion and an understanding of how the connected world has blurred the lines between how customers interact with brands.
This is a great opportunity to come in and make a huge impact on the digital customer experience at a dynamic and highly visible consumer brand, impacting millions of peoples’ lives while working in a collaborative team environment with an unrivaled culture. Come join us and have some fun!
The impact you can have
Own the product vision and roadmap for Knitwell’s iOS and Android apps, aligning with business objectives and customer needs
Collaborate with Director of App to define priorities and align with the Knitwell app roadmap
Partner with key business stakeholders (Brand, Merchandising, Planning, IT) to elicit and develop feature requirements that align with roadmap and deliver incremental business value
Develop feature requirements (epics, user stories and acceptance criteria) in an agile environment with focus on iterative MVP releases, future learning and ability to pivot
Manage the full agile delivery cycle of new feature requirements: app design, feasibility, sizing, solutioning, implementation, QA, UAT, release and measurement
Manage app design for assigned features, leading a designer from hypothesis through design reviews and selection with ability to communicate and align stakeholders
Establish and conduct continual discovery cycles for the product to maximize customer insights, competitor activity, feature requirements, vendors and technologies, feature performance and industry trends
Provide input to Director on future roadmap opportunities
You’ll bring to the role
Min 5 years of experience in ecommerce product management
Native app experience a plus
Bachelor’s degree required in a related field
8+ years of professional experience in branded retail, ecommerce or consulting environment
Strong quantitative, analytical, and problem-solving skills
Experience using Adobe Analytics (or equivalent) to develop hypotheses, define KPIS and drive outcomes
Experience using tools like Monday.com and Adobe Target (or equivalent) to plan, prioritize and execute both test and personalization at scale
Experience using JIRA and demonstrated success using Agile methods
Excellent communication and project management skills – ability to communicate with internal and external clients to gain understanding of needs with ability to translate those effectively into software requirements.
An entrepreneurial spirit with the ability to work independently and a collaborative environment
